Originally Posted by Dynamic
After only a 35 mile ride I was getting some ugly lower back pain which I usually do not get.
what causes this? I sure would like to fix it :/

Did you recently change your set up, moving seat higher, flipping your post or something else that would lead to a more aggressive position? If not, and you usually don't have problems at that distance, it could be tight hamstrings, strained muscles in your hip girdle, weak core, etc. You could also have strained something back there either on or off the bike. See how you feel tomorrow, and maybe start doing stretching before getting on the bike in the short term, and core strengthening/flexibility exercises in the long term.
